Ordinals
beta
Sat 1412482014366592
decimal
354992.2014366592
degree
0°144992′176″2014366592‴
percentile
67.26104837715823%
name
dvpgiwwblxp
cycle
0
epoch
1
period
176
block
354992
offset
2014366592
timestamp
2015-05-05 01:09:44 UTC
rarity
common
prev
next